CVE-2007-3368: Buffer Overflow

Published Jun 22, 2007
·
Updated

Buffer overflow in the HTTP server on the Polycom SoundPoint IP 601 SIP phone with BootROM 3.0.x+ allows remote attackers to cause a denial of service (device reboot) via a malformed CGI parameter.
